Day 10 - Kitty Hawk, Outer Banks, NC

The Wright Brothers National Monument is a vast area that was the site of the first powered flight in 1903. The picture of the monument shows kids in the field flying their kites. There's a visitor's center with replicas of the Wright's first plane and some interesting talks. I found it especially interesting to realize that the first powered flight was in 1903 and when the 1st World War started in 1914 they had war planes. The Wright's taught the world to fly and the world sure learned fast. I learned many things today!
